Reducing Technical Debt through Data-Driven Prioritisation: From Intuition to Evidence
Today's fast-paced technology environment means organisations face mounting technical debt that constrains innovation, increases operational risk, and erodes efficiency. Despite widespread recognition of these challenges, many struggle to address technical debt systematically, relying on intuition rather than evidence for prioritisation decisions. My experience working with enterprises across regulated industries has demonstrated that reducing technical debt effectively requires more than technical awareness—it demands a data-driven approach that connects technical issues to business impact and enables strategic prioritisation.
David Hole / Andy Ingram
4/17/20255 min read
The problem with having a fast-paced technological environment is that organisations face mounting technical debt that restricts innovation, increases operational risk, and erodes efficiency. Despite widespread recognition of these challenges, many struggle to address technical debt systematically, relying more on intuition than evidence for priority decisions. My experience working with enterprises across regulated industries has demonstrated that reducing technical debt effectively requires more than technical awareness—it demands a data-driven approach that connects technical issues to business impacts and enables strategic prioritisation.
The Technical Debt Challenge
Organisations typically encounter significant obstacles when attempting to manage technical debt:
Difficulty quantifying the business impact of technical compromises
Competing perspectives on prioritisation from technical and business stakeholders
Limited visibility into the full extent of debt across application portfolios
Incomplete understanding of interdependencies between debt items
Lack of structured processes for debt identification and management
Insufficient mechanisms for preventing new debt accumulation
Budget constraints that limit remediation capacity
Without a data-driven approach, technical debt reduction efforts often focus on the most visible or recently problematic issues rather than those with the greatest business impact. This reactive approach leads to suboptimal allocation of limited remediation resources and fails to address systemic causes of debt accumulation.
The Evangelize Performance Framework for Technical Debt Management
The Evangelize Performance Framework offers a systematic approach to technical debt reduction through eight interconnected steps:
1. Technical Debt Discovery and Inventory
A comprehensive assessment of your organization's technological estate identifies existing technical debts across applications, infrastructure, data, and security domains. This discovery process utilises multiple identification methods—from static code analysis and architectural reviews to operational incident patterns and performance metrics.
The assessment creates a centralised inventory of technical debt items with standardised metadata, including the debt type, affected components, estimated remediation effort, and current mitigations. This inventory provides the foundation for meaningful analysis and prioritisation, moving beyond anecdotal awareness to documented visibility across the technological landscape.
By establishing a comprehensive debt inventory, organisations gain clarity on the full extent of technical compromises and can move from managing individual symptoms to addressing systemic patterns of debt accumulation. This comprehensive visibility is essential for developing effective reduction strategies.
2. Business Impact Analysis
Understanding how technical debt affects business outcomes reveals the true cost of deferred maintenance and technical compromises. By mapping the relationship between technical issues and business impacts across dimensions such as operational performance, customer experience, security risks, and innovation capacity, organisations can translate technical concerns into business-relevant consequences.
This analysis examines both direct impacts (such as increased incidents or response time degradation) and indirect effects (such as delayed feature delivery or increased operational costs). By quantifying these consequences in business terms—from revenue impacts and customer satisfaction to regulatory compliance and market responsiveness—organisations create a compelling case for debt reduction beyond technical considerations.
The business impact analysis provides essential context for prioritisation decisions, ensuring that limited remediation resources focus on debt items with the greatest effect on strategic business outcomes rather than purely technical interests.
3. Technical Debt Classification and Categorisation
Technology Business Management (TBM) principles help categorise debt items based on root causes, business impact patterns, and remediation approaches. This structured categorisation enables a meaningful analysis of debt portfolios and facilitates the identification of systemic improvement opportunities beyond individual fixes.
Classification dimensions could include how the debt started (intentional choices versus accidental issues), the area it affects (like security, performance, architecture, etc.), how hard it is to fix, and how important it is to the business. By applying consistent categorisation, organisations can identify patterns that inform tactical remediation priorities and strategic prevention initiatives.
This classification approach transforms technical debt from an amorphous challenge into a structured portfolio that can be managed using established investment principles and governance mechanisms.
4. Risk-Based Prioritisation Model
Developing a multidimensional prioritisation framework that incorporates business impacts, technical risks, remediation costs, and strategic alignment ensures balanced decision-making. This data-driven model enables objective comparison of diverse debt items across the technology portfolio.
The priority model assigns quantitative scores across key dimensions, creating a composite ranking that balances immediate operational concerns with long-term strategic considerations. By incorporating both risk factors and business value, the model ensures remediation efforts focus on debt items that present the greatest strategic threat rather than simply the most recent technical challenges.
This evidence-based approach transforms prioritisation from subjective debates into data-driven decisions, enabling a more effective allocation of limited remediation resources and a clearer justification of investment priorities.
5. Technical Debt Metrics and Dashboards
Defining comprehensive metrics that span technical quality, operational impact, and business consequences ensures balanced visibility. This approach creates a measurement framework demonstrating how technical debt affects organisational performance across multiple dimensions.
Dashboards provide tailored views for different stakeholders—from technical metrics focused on specific quality attributes to executive summaries highlighting business impact and remediation progress. By connecting technical indicators with business outcomes, these visualisations create a shared understanding of debt consequences and reduction priorities.
The metrics framework allows for continuous monitoring of debt growth and efforts to fix it, ensuring responsibility for reducing debt goals and pointing out areas that need more focus or funding.
6. Structured Remediation Business Case Development
The Five-Case Model provides a comprehensive framework for technical debt reduction initiatives:
Strategic Case: Aligns debt reduction with organisational resilience and agility objectives
Economic Case: Quantifies benefits across risk reduction, efficiency improvement, and innovation enablement
Management Case: Defines governance structures and delivery approaches
Financial Case: Provides investment justification with clear benefit realisation timelines
Commercial Case: Evaluates delivery models and capability requirements
This structured approach ensures debt reduction initiatives have clear business justification and executive sponsorship, addressing both immediate remediation priorities and the systematic changes required to prevent future accumulation.
7. Technical Debt Prevention Mechanisms
Drawing from a root-cause analysis of existing debt, organisations can implement prevention mechanisms like architecture review boards, technical standards, automated quality gates, and developer education programs that address the systemic causes of debt accumulation.
These preventive measures change the approach from fixing problems after they happen to managing quality ahead of time, making sure that new projects meet the right technical standards while also considering important business trade-offs. By implementing structured processes for technical decision-making, organisations can distinguish between deliberate short-term compromises with manageable consequences and unintentional quality degradation.
Prevention mechanisms transform technical debt management from a cleanup exercise into a sustainable discipline that balances delivery velocity with technical sustainability.
8. Continuous Debt Management Programme
Combining all elements of a comprehensive program ensures sustainable technical debt management with clear governance structures, ongoing identification mechanisms, and integrated remediation plans. This program integrates debt considerations into the technology lifecycle—from architecture and development to testing and operations.
The continuous management approach acknowledges that technical debt is not a one-time challenge but an ongoing aspect of technology management that requires consistent attention and disciplined processes. By embedding debt management in regular technology practices, organisations create sustainable mechanisms for maintaining technical health.
Key Benefits of Data-Driven Technical Debt Management
Implementing this framework delivers significant benefits:
Enhanced business alignment through impact-based prioritisation
Improved resource allocation focused on high-impact remediation
Reduced operational incidents through proactive risk mitigation
Accelerated innovation through removal of technical constraints
Sustainable technology practices that prevent debt accumulation
Real-World Impact
Organisations that implement structured technical debt management typically achieve:
25-40% reduction in critical incidents related to technical debt
30-50% improvement in development velocity through constraint removal
Significant enhancement in system reliability and performance
More effective allocation of limited remediation resources
Clearer justification for maintenance investments based on business impact
Getting Started
Begin your technical debt reduction journey with these practical steps:
Create a centralised inventory of technical debt across your technology estate
Develop a simple impact rating system to identify high-consequence debt items
Implement basic health metrics to track debt trends across key systems
Create cross-functional forums to review debt impact and prioritisation
Establish governance processes that balance new features with debt reduction
The most successful debt reduction programs start by creating visibility, establishing business-aligned priorities, and developing sustainable practices that balance immediate delivery with long-term technical health.
By implementing a data-driven approach to technical debt management, organisations can transform their technological practices from cycles of accumulation and crisis to sustainable discipline that maintains technical health while delivering business value.
This article outlines key elements of the Evangelize Performance Framework for technology cost transparency. For more information on implementing these approaches in your organisation, connect with me at info@evangelize-consulting.com.